I'm thinking of booking flights Amsterdam-Seoul and Seoul-Amsterdam via Beijing.

For the outbound flight the transfer time is 4 hours 25 minutes, which must be sufficient, but the transfer time for the return flight is 1 hour 40 minutes. Would that be enough time? And what does the transfer procedure involve?

It's international to international transfer. In general, you need at least an hour to make this connection. Thus 1hr40mins is also enough. Don't worry. The correct transfer procedures are the following:
Flight Arrival - Transfer Procedures - Stamped on the Boarding Pass - Security Check - Custom Inspection - Waiting & Boarding
